MORE DETAILS & SPECS
* The most powerful whole-home backup solution
* From 6kWh-90kWh capacity, for month-long power security.
* Stackable Design DIY Friendly Plug-and-Play
* Scalable from 1 × 6kWh battery to 15 units, offering a gigantic 90kWh.
For a typical American household during blackouts, that's over 30 days of minimum energy use*.
A flexible system of plug-and-play, DIY expansion. Stack and connect two Lego-like units in minutes, and the power's all set. Conveniently organize battery storage to save space.
* 7.2kW-21.6kW, 120V & 240V Output. One unit, all appliances covered, even 3-ton central a/c (LRA within 120A)
* One inverter has a 7.2kW and split phase output (120/240V), to power every single home appliance, even a 3-ton central air conditioner*(peaking at 10.8kW for 10 seconds).
* Plug-and-play design with tons of outlets, including 30-amp sockets, that enables you to power your home immediately, even if you're using EcoFlow DELTA Pro Ultra as a portable power station.
7200W output is guaranteed without restricting input power, which EcoFlow DELTA Pro can not.
* 5.6kW-16.8kW Solar Input. Industry's FASTEST solar recharging speed
Using a combination of high and low-voltage PV input, a single inverter can achieve an incredible 5.6kW input. Combine 3 EcoFlow DELTA Pro Ultra inverters and 42× 400W solar panels, and get an epic 16.8kW input, to generate an entire day's worth of energy in just 1 hour.
EcoFlow DELTA Pro Ultra allows you to customize your power using a flexible or rooftop solar system and make energy independence a reality.
* AC Always on
The AC output power button will be turned on automatically once DELTA Pro Ultra has power, which ensures that appliances work even when you are not at home.
